Court dismisses suit challenging trial of Onnoghen

Peter Abang, the claimant who is also a lawyer, had instituted the suit, challenging the jurisdiction of the CCT in prosecuting Onnoghen.

The claimant’s counsel, in response, argued that issues had not been joined and he further stated that the rules of the court allowed party at any time or stage of proceedings to discontinue with his case. He concluded by saying, “in the circumstance, this suit is hereby dismissed. I make no order as to cost”.
